Abstract

The luminescent characteristics of the LiSrPO4, Sr9Sc(PO4)7, K3Lu(PO4)2 and K3LuSi2O7 microcrystalline powders doped with Pr3+ ions, a promising optical materials for scintillation applications, were investigated using various experimental techniques.
